Sefa seizes 46 tons of soy in Dom Eliseu

Merchandise valued at R$ 100,165.00 originates from Santa Maria das Barreiras, Pará, and is destined for Porto Franco, Maranhão

By Ana Márcia Pantoja (SEFA)
16/06/2025 17h26

State tax inspectors from the State Department of Finance (Sefa) seized, on Sunday (15), 46 tons of soy, merchandise valued at R$ 100,165.00, originating from Santa Maria das Barreiras, Pará, and destined for Porto Franco, Maranhão. The officials are assigned to the Coordination of Goods in Transit Control in Itinga, in the municipality of Dom Eliseu, northeastern Pará.

“The merchandise was covered by a shipping invoice with a specific purpose of export. However, it was found, in the analysis conducted by the inspection team, that the sender does not have a Special Tax Regime authorized by Sefa. According to current legislation, this condition is essential for the operation to benefit from the non-incidence of ICMS,” informed the coordinator of the tax unit, Rafael Brasil.

The merchandise was retained and a Seizure and Deposit Term (TAD) was drawn up, in the amount of R$ 19,231.68, referring to ICMS and fines.
